The FBI, like most federal departments, relies on the U.S. government service (GS) pay scales for hiring and job advancement. An entry-level intelligence analyst with a bachelor's degree is typically hired at the GS-7 level, while a graduate degree-holder will start at GS-9. Analysts can advance within the FBI to the highest level of GS-15.Jul 1, 2021 · Behavior Analyst Salary in India and Abroad. Oct 20, 2023 · Applied Behavior Analysis, commonly called ABA, is a type of therapy that concentrates on the improvement of certain behaviors, including communication, social abilities, and reading. It also helps enhance adaptive learning abilities, like domestic skills, personal hygiene, and fine motor dexterity.
